🔥 Which glute exercise packs the biggest punch?⁠

🍑 Collings et al. (2023) set out to determine gluteal muscle forces across different exercises.⁠ ⁠

📊 The authors ranked the exercises into different tiers based on the estimated muscle forces.⁠ ⁠

🏆️ The single leg RDL with resistance was the only exercise to be ranked a Tier 1 exercise in all three muscle groups.⁠ ⁠

🥇 Meanwhile, the body weight side plank was ranked as a Tier 1 exercise for the gluteus minimus and medius. ⁠ ⁠

💡 For rehabilitation purposes, we may want to consider utilizing lower tier exercises and/or reducing load for those that are more load compromised, and higher tier exercises for those that are able to tolerate higher muscle forces.

💡 The popliteus muscle dry needling technique combined with therapeutic exercise for the treatment of Knee osteoarthritis presented better results in pain, function, stiffness, strength, and kinesiophobia compared to the compared to the control group (TE with simulated DN).

👉🏻 This is from the new paper "Effects of dry needling combined with exercise on knee osteoarthritis at 6 month follow up a randomized clinical trial" by Agost-González et al 2025

💡 The combination of manual therapy with exercise may result in a moderate increase in function but no reduction in pain when compared with placebo for primarily chronic neck pain.

👉🏻 This is from the new paper "Manual therapy with exercise for neck pain" by Chacko et al 2025
